working on my sons Honda civic hatchback. It wont start. It has spark at the plugs. The fuel pump won't prime and has no power at the harness connecting to the pump. Took the pump out and put 12 volts directly to the pump and it works. Checked the relay based on information I found on the internet and it seems to have continuity where it should when 12 volts are applied to the different posts of the relay. What next?

Key off.
Unplug ECU connector A.
Ground pin A7 or A8 in the connector.
Turn key to ON(II) and listen for whether the pump primes.
Repeat ground test multiple times to check whether the pump primes with A/7/A8 grounded.

Unplug main relay.
Turn key to ON(II).
Two of the eight pins in the connector should read battery voltage to body ground.
Post the voltage readings and the two pins and wire colors that show battery voltage.
